Extruded … WebUnderfloor Screed Floor Ducting Range www.pendock.co.uk The Encasement Specialist Pendock floor ducting is a two-part system comprising a pre-formed tray, and a 12mm plywood cover, designed for fixing to the surface of the sub-floor before screeding. Manufactured from hot dipped mild steel Single or multi compartment versions

WebAitkens In-Screed Floor Duct System is manufactured from galvanised steel in accordance with BS EN 10327 : 2004 and is designed to comply with the requirements of BS4678 Part 2. The duct incorporates an integral quick assembly coupler and intermediate fixing clamps, to ensure an efficient site installation.
